Transaction c95923e70b29296caa95a7cffd05dfa2525dde4a5eee35c343911c8a8367098e

1 Input
2 Outputs
  • c95923e70b29296caa95a7cffd05dfa2525dde4a5eee35c343911c8a8367098e:0
  • value  143317693
    address  1EHrKMahHF57rMjo4mgGo2s6Q6D8XCmCwA
  • c95923e70b29296caa95a7cffd05dfa2525dde4a5eee35c343911c8a8367098e:1
  • value  1087616
    address  1JfYDggsBtffZhJpZRqVZw6FBbF5GCDTnP